*** Highest and Best Tuesday at 5pm*** Steeped in history and brimming with character, this one-of-a-kind craftsman-style home is a true gem. Built in the 1940s by famed Broadway actor Greek Evans, it sits on the former site of a 5,000-seat outdoor amphitheater, carrying with it a legacy as rich as its design. Inside, the vaulted great room showcases post-and-beam construction, a rustic fieldstone fireplace, pecky cypress paneling, custom built-ins, and an abundance of windows that flood the space with natural light. The functional kitchen features granite countertops, while the adjacent sunroom, with its slate flooring and walls of windows, offers a private retreat. Hardwood floors run through most of the home, enhancing its warmth and timeless charm. The main level includes two bedrooms and a full bath, while a private third bedroom awaits upstairs. The lower level features a garage, laundry, and additional storage. Nestled in a wooded setting with multiple patios, this home blends privacy with convenience--minutes from both the Merritt Parkway and I-95, shopping, dining, Cranbury Park, Wilton Town Center, and the "WilWalk" section of the Norwalk River Valley Trail.
